In the past two decades, the popularity of golf
in Atlantic Canada and the golf industry itself have both seen
tremendous growth. Since the beginning of this growth, Eastern
Turf has been one of the premier industry suppliers, focusing on
providing exceptional products backed by exceptional service.
In 1987, the Equipment Division of the Halifax Seed Company –
Canada’s oldest seed supply company – moved into its own facility
in Burnside Park at 140 Ilsley Avenue, a location they still call
home. In December of that same year, the new company led by Paul
Tregunno officially became Eastern Turf Products Limited.
Eastern Turf Products initially focused on the consumer market,
representing a wide range of homeowner products such as mowers,
trimmers, chippers, tractors and Troy-Bilt tillers. The company
also supplied local golf courses with turf equipment and
servicing, and course maintenance supplies. These relationships
would prove valuable as the popularity of golf and Atlantic Canada
as a golf destination took off in the ‘90s.
In 1998, long time company employees Michael Moore and Tom Jubis
took an ownership role in the company as President and
Vice-President respectively.
To reflect the increased focus on the golf and turf industry, the
company changed its name to Eastern Turf Inc in 2001. From the
Eastern web site:
“The turf industry has become our main life
line. While our major supplier is Jacobsen, we also supply and
service products from various other manufacturers such as National
Mower Company, Turfco Mfg., Smithco, Kubota, Progressive, Foley &
Redexim.
We also carry golf course accessories from Standard Golf, Par
Aide, Bayco and Miltona Turf Products…. (and) we provide
fertilizer such as Par Ex, Grigg Bros., Milorganite and wetting
agents from Precision Laboratories.”
